




版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領
文檔簡介
基于區(qū)塊鏈的可信簡歷認證系統(tǒng)的設計與實現(xiàn)一、引言隨著互聯(lián)網(wǎng)的快速發(fā)展,人才招聘與選拔已經(jīng)成為企業(yè)發(fā)展的重要環(huán)節(jié)。然而,傳統(tǒng)的簡歷認證方式存在著諸多問題,如信息不透明、易篡改、信任度低等。為了解決這些問題,本文提出了一種基于區(qū)塊鏈的可信簡歷認證系統(tǒng)。該系統(tǒng)利用區(qū)塊鏈技術的去中心化、不可篡改和可追溯等特點,為簡歷的認證和存儲提供了全新的解決方案。二、系統(tǒng)設計1.系統(tǒng)架構本系統(tǒng)采用分布式架構,主要包括前端界面、后端服務、區(qū)塊鏈網(wǎng)絡和數(shù)據(jù)庫存儲四個部分。前端界面負責用戶交互,后端服務負責業(yè)務邏輯處理,區(qū)塊鏈網(wǎng)絡用于存儲和傳輸簡歷數(shù)據(jù),數(shù)據(jù)庫存儲用于存儲系統(tǒng)配置和用戶信息。2.關鍵技術(1)區(qū)塊鏈技術:采用公有鏈和私有鏈相結合的方式,確保數(shù)據(jù)的安全性和隱私性。公有鏈用于存儲公共簡歷數(shù)據(jù),私有鏈用于存儲企業(yè)敏感數(shù)據(jù)。(2)智能合約:利用智能合約實現(xiàn)簡歷的自動認證和授權訪問,提高系統(tǒng)的自動化程度。(3)加密技術:采用高級加密算法對數(shù)據(jù)進行加密,確保數(shù)據(jù)在傳輸和存儲過程中的安全性。3.功能模塊(1)用戶模塊:包括用戶注冊、登錄、信息修改等功能。(2)簡歷模塊:用戶可上傳、更新和查看自己的簡歷信息。系統(tǒng)采用區(qū)塊鏈技術,確保簡歷數(shù)據(jù)的不可篡改和可追溯。(3)認證模塊:該模塊是本系統(tǒng)的核心部分。系統(tǒng)利用區(qū)塊鏈的智能合約,對簡歷進行自動認證。認證過程包括對簡歷數(shù)據(jù)的校驗、身份信息的核對以及學歷、工作經(jīng)歷等背景調(diào)查。通過智能合約的自動化處理,大大提高了認證的效率和準確性。(4)授權訪問模塊:經(jīng)過認證的簡歷數(shù)據(jù)被存儲在區(qū)塊鏈網(wǎng)絡中,只有經(jīng)過授權的用戶或機構才能訪問。該模塊負責處理用戶的訪問請求,通過智能合約實現(xiàn)自動授權和訪問控制。(5)數(shù)據(jù)統(tǒng)計與分析模塊:該模塊用于對簡歷數(shù)據(jù)進行統(tǒng)計和分析,為企業(yè)提供人才市場的數(shù)據(jù)支持。例如,企業(yè)可以通過該模塊了解某一行業(yè)或地區(qū)的求職者數(shù)量、求職者的學歷分布、工作經(jīng)驗等信息。三、系統(tǒng)實現(xiàn)1.前端界面實現(xiàn)前端界面采用現(xiàn)代化的Web開發(fā)技術,如HTML5、CSS3和JavaScript等,提供友好的用戶交互界面。同時,前端界面還需要與后端服務進行通信,以實現(xiàn)用戶操作和業(yè)務處理。2.后端服務實現(xiàn)后端服務采用微服務架構,將系統(tǒng)功能劃分為多個獨立的服務模塊,如用戶管理服務、簡歷管理服務、認證服務、授權訪問服務等。每個服務模塊負責處理特定的業(yè)務邏輯,通過API接口與前端界面進行通信。3.區(qū)塊鏈網(wǎng)絡實現(xiàn)區(qū)塊鏈網(wǎng)絡是本系統(tǒng)的核心部分,采用去中心化的方式存儲和傳輸簡歷數(shù)據(jù)。系統(tǒng)采用公有鏈和私有鏈相結合的方式,確保數(shù)據(jù)的安全性和隱私性。同時,系統(tǒng)還需要實現(xiàn)與智能合約的集成,以實現(xiàn)簡歷的自動認證和授權訪問。4.數(shù)據(jù)庫存儲實現(xiàn)數(shù)據(jù)庫存儲用于存儲系統(tǒng)配置和用戶信息,包括用戶注冊信息、簡歷數(shù)據(jù)、系統(tǒng)日志等。數(shù)據(jù)庫采用關系型數(shù)據(jù)庫和非關系型數(shù)據(jù)庫相結合的方式,以提高系統(tǒng)的可擴展性和性能。四、系統(tǒng)測試與優(yōu)化在系統(tǒng)開發(fā)和實現(xiàn)過程中,需要進行嚴格的測試和優(yōu)化,以確保系統(tǒng)的穩(wěn)定性和性能。測試過程包括功能測試、性能測試、安全測試等。在優(yōu)化過程中,需要對系統(tǒng)進行性能調(diào)優(yōu)、代碼優(yōu)化等操作,以提高系統(tǒng)的響應速度和用戶體驗。五、總結與展望本文提出了一種基于區(qū)塊鏈的可信簡歷認證系統(tǒng),為簡歷的認證和存儲提供了全新的解決方案。該系統(tǒng)具有去中心化、不可篡改和可追溯等特點,可以有效解決傳統(tǒng)簡歷認證方式中存在的問題。未來,隨著區(qū)塊鏈技術的不斷發(fā)展和應用,該系統(tǒng)將在人才招聘與選拔領域發(fā)揮更大的作用。六、系統(tǒng)設計與實現(xiàn)細節(jié)接下來,我們將深入探討基于區(qū)塊鏈的可信簡歷認證系統(tǒng)的設計與實現(xiàn)細節(jié)。6.1系統(tǒng)架構設計本系統(tǒng)采用微服務架構,將各個功能模塊進行解耦,實現(xiàn)高內(nèi)聚、低耦合的設計目標。系統(tǒng)整體架構分為四層:用戶層、業(yè)務邏輯層、區(qū)塊鏈層和存儲層。用戶層負責與前端界面進行交互;業(yè)務邏輯層處理用戶的請求,與區(qū)塊鏈層和存儲層進行交互;區(qū)塊鏈層負責簡歷數(shù)據(jù)的上鏈和智能合約的交互;存儲層則負責系統(tǒng)配置和用戶信息的存儲。6.2用戶界面與API接口用戶界面采用現(xiàn)代化的Web技術實現(xiàn),提供友好的用戶體驗。通過API接口,前端界面與系統(tǒng)進行通信。API接口設計遵循RESTful風格,提供注冊、登錄、上傳簡歷、查看簡歷、修改簡歷等功能。在API接口的實現(xiàn)中,我們需要對輸入進行驗證,防止惡意請求和注入攻擊。同時,為了確保數(shù)據(jù)的安全性,我們需要對API接口進行加密處理。6.3區(qū)塊鏈網(wǎng)絡實現(xiàn)區(qū)塊鏈網(wǎng)絡是本系統(tǒng)的核心部分,我們采用公有鏈和私有鏈相結合的方式。公有鏈用于公開透明的數(shù)據(jù)傳輸,而私有鏈則用于存儲敏感的簡歷數(shù)據(jù)。在區(qū)塊鏈網(wǎng)絡中,我們使用智能合約來實現(xiàn)簡歷的自動認證和授權訪問。智能合約是一種自動執(zhí)行的合同,當滿足一定條件時,可以自動執(zhí)行相應的操作。通過智能合約,我們可以實現(xiàn)簡歷數(shù)據(jù)的不可篡改和可追溯。6.4數(shù)據(jù)庫存儲實現(xiàn)數(shù)據(jù)庫存儲采用關系型數(shù)據(jù)庫(如MySQL)和非關系型數(shù)據(jù)庫(如MongoDB)相結合的方式。關系型數(shù)據(jù)庫用于存儲系統(tǒng)配置和用戶信息等結構化數(shù)據(jù),非關系型數(shù)據(jù)庫則用于存儲簡歷數(shù)據(jù)等非結構化數(shù)據(jù)。通過這種方式,我們可以充分利用兩種數(shù)據(jù)庫的優(yōu)點,提高系統(tǒng)的可擴展性和性能。同時,為了確保數(shù)據(jù)的安全性,我們需要對數(shù)據(jù)庫進行加密處理,并定期進行備份和恢復測試。6.5系統(tǒng)測試與優(yōu)化在系統(tǒng)開發(fā)和實現(xiàn)過程中,我們需要進行嚴格的測試和優(yōu)化。測試過程包括功能測試、性能測試、安全測試等。在功能測試中,我們需要驗證系統(tǒng)的各個功能是否正常工作;在性能測試中,我們需要測試系統(tǒng)的響應時間和吞吐量等性能指標;在安全測試中,我們需要測試系統(tǒng)的安全性能,如輸入驗證、加密處理等。在優(yōu)化過程中,我們需要對系統(tǒng)進行性能調(diào)優(yōu)、代碼優(yōu)化等操作,以提高系統(tǒng)的響應速度和用戶體驗。同時,我們還需要定期對系統(tǒng)進行維護和升級,以確保系統(tǒng)的穩(wěn)定性和安全性。七、系統(tǒng)安全與隱私保護在基于區(qū)塊鏈的可信簡歷認證系統(tǒng)中,安全和隱私保護是至關重要的。我們采取多種措施來確保系統(tǒng)的安全和用戶的隱私。首先,我們采用加密技術對數(shù)據(jù)進行加密處理,確保數(shù)據(jù)在傳輸和存儲過程中的安全性。其次,我們采用訪問控制和權限管理等技術來確保只有授權用戶才能訪問敏感數(shù)據(jù)。此外,我們還定期對系統(tǒng)進行安全審計和漏洞掃描,及時發(fā)現(xiàn)和修復安全問題。最后,我們還采取隱私保護措施來保護用戶的隱私信息不被泄露和濫用??偨Y起來八、未來展望本文提出的基于區(qū)塊鏈的可信簡歷認證系統(tǒng)具有諸多優(yōu)勢和發(fā)展?jié)摿?。未來隨著區(qū)塊鏈技術的不斷發(fā)展和應用推廣以及大數(shù)據(jù)技術的深入應用我們可以期待以下幾點:1.系統(tǒng)性能將得到進一步提升:隨著技術的進步我們可以對系統(tǒng)架構進行優(yōu)化以提升系統(tǒng)的響應速度和吞吐量提高用戶體驗。2.擴展更多的應用場景:除了簡歷認證外我們還可以將該系統(tǒng)應用于其他領域如證書管理、身份驗證等為更多用戶提供服務。3.增強隱私保護措施:隨著隱私保護意識的提高我們將不斷改進隱私保護措施以更好地保護用戶的隱私信息不被泄露和濫用。4.拓展國際合作與交流:隨著全球化趨勢的加強我們可以與其他國家的相關機構和企業(yè)開展合作與交流共同推動區(qū)塊鏈技術在人才招聘與選拔領域的發(fā)展與應用為全球人才流動提供更好的服務與支持。總之基于區(qū)塊鏈的可信簡歷認證系統(tǒng)具有廣闊的發(fā)展前景和應用價值未來將在人才招聘與選拔領域發(fā)揮更大的作用推動人力資源行業(yè)的發(fā)展與創(chuàng)新。四、系統(tǒng)設計與實現(xiàn)基于區(qū)塊鏈的可信簡歷認證系統(tǒng)旨在為招聘者和求職者提供一個安全、可靠、可追溯的簡歷認證平臺。下面將詳細介紹該系統(tǒng)的設計與實現(xiàn)。1.系統(tǒng)架構設計系統(tǒng)架構設計是整個系統(tǒng)設計與實現(xiàn)的基礎。我們采用了分布式、去中心化的區(qū)塊鏈技術,構建了一個包括前端、后端、智能合約和區(qū)塊鏈網(wǎng)絡的多層次架構。前端部分主要負責用戶界面的展示和交互,采用流行的Web技術棧,如HTML5、CSS3和JavaScript等,為用戶提供友好的操作界面。后端部分負責處理前端的請求,與智能合約和區(qū)塊鏈網(wǎng)絡進行交互,采用微服務架構,提高系統(tǒng)的可擴展性和可維護性。智能合約部分負責定義和執(zhí)行系統(tǒng)中的各種業(yè)務邏輯,如簡歷的上傳、認證、查詢等操作。區(qū)塊鏈網(wǎng)絡部分負責存儲和傳輸數(shù)據(jù),采用公有鏈或聯(lián)盟鏈的形式,確保數(shù)據(jù)的可靠性和安全性。2.用戶認證與授權為了保障系統(tǒng)的安全性,我們采用了多層次的用戶認證與授權機制。首先,用戶在前端進行注冊,填寫基本信息和身份證明材料。后端對用戶信息進行驗證,確保用戶身份的真實性。然后,系統(tǒng)為每個用戶生成一個唯一的數(shù)字身份標識,用于在區(qū)塊鏈網(wǎng)絡中進行身份驗證和授權。在用戶授權方面,我們采用了基于角色的訪問控制(RBAC)模型,為不同角色的用戶分配不同的權限。例如,招聘者可以查看和搜索所有簡歷,而求職者只能查看和修改自己的簡歷。同時,系統(tǒng)還支持對敏感信息的訪問進行特殊授權,確保只有經(jīng)過授權的用戶才能訪問特定數(shù)據(jù)。3.簡歷的上傳與認證求職者通過前端界面上傳簡歷,后端對簡歷進行格式和內(nèi)容檢查,確保簡歷的合法性和有效性。然后,系統(tǒng)將簡歷信息寫入智能合約,并觸發(fā)智能合約的認證邏輯。智能合約根據(jù)預設的規(guī)則對簡歷進行自動認證,如驗證學歷、工作經(jīng)歷等信息。一旦簡歷通過認證,其數(shù)據(jù)將被永久記錄在區(qū)塊鏈網(wǎng)絡上,無法篡改。4.系統(tǒng)實現(xiàn)與測試系統(tǒng)實現(xiàn)采用模塊化設計,將各個功能模塊進行拆分和封裝,便于開發(fā)和維護。在開發(fā)過程中,我們使用了
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
- 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 醫(yī)院居間合同范本
- 招標公司服務合同范本
- 南京耐磨地坪合同范本
- 叉車代理銷售合同范本
- 個人房屋轉讓協(xié)議書
- 1+X繼保試題含參考答案
- 與個人搬運合同范本
- 辦公改造合同范本
- 高壓電工作業(yè)復習題+參考答案
- 三八婦女節(jié)活動邀請函
- 2022年四川省綿陽市中考語文真題
- 麥琪的禮物全面英文詳細介紹
- 使用智能手機教程文檔
- 數(shù)字資產(chǎn)培訓課件
- (醫(yī)院安全生產(chǎn)培訓)課件
- 大檔案盒正面、側面標簽模板
- 幼兒園優(yōu)質(zhì)公開課:中班數(shù)學《到艾比家做客》課件
- 保潔巡查記錄表
- 部編人教版歷史八年級下冊《三大改造》省優(yōu)質(zhì)課一等獎教案
- 水輪機調(diào)速器現(xiàn)場調(diào)試
- 貴州省體育高考評分標準
評論
0/150
提交評論